Founders Law LLP is hiring a commercial transactions associate to work directly with Corey Gerson, who leads the firm's commercial practice. You would be handling the agreements our clients run their businesses on and helping to build a rapidly-scaling practice area.

What we're looking for
- Two to six years of practice as a licensed attorney, in good standing in at least one U.S. jurisdiction.
- At least two years on an in-house commercial legal team at a technology company, ideally in SaaS or AI, working under senior commercial attorneys.
- Practical experience with data privacy where it meets commercial work, including negotiating DPAs and drafting or reviewing privacy policies.
- Tech transactions experience at a law firm is a plus, but not a requirement.
- Comfort working directly with clients, the judgment to raise issues early, and an interest in areas of practice that are new to you.
